    Summary You will serve as a TRAINING SPECIALIST in the Surface Combat Systems Training Command Hampton Roads (SCSTC HR) and Learning Site HR of SURFCOMSYSTRNCMD HAMPTON ROADS. Responsibilities You will use software applications to measure and assess the effectiveness of training programs. You will provide support for Training Support Programs and Testing Programs. You will brief management to provide a current status on resources and training programs. You will review, develop, revise, and change curriculum products. You will resolve potential training problems by identifying issues and proposing solutions or developing approaches to solve the problem. You will develop and publish course or schedule publications or notifications for training programs. Requirements Conditions of Employment Qualifications GS-09:Your resume must demonstrate at least one year of specialized experience at or equivalent to the GS-07 grade level or pay band in the Federal service or equivalent experience in the private or public sector. Specialized experience must demonstrate the following: (1) Applying conventional and established training methods, techniques, and tools to design and develop training courses and materials, evaluate training programs, lead and complete special projects and implement program and procedural changes and process improvements. (2) Overseeing development of curriculum support documents such as Training Project Plans, Training Course Control Documents, Lesson Plan, Trainee Guide and Instructional Media Materials and Testing Plans according to established guidelines. (3) Using Authoring Instructional Materials, Content Planning Module/Learning Object Module authoring tools software, and various training support databases such as Corporate Enterprise Training Activity Resource System (CeTARs) used to update course materials to include complete whole or new courses of instruction, changes or course revisions. GS-07:Your resume must demonstrate at least one year of specialized experience at or equivalent to the GS-05 grade level or pay band in the Federal service or equivalent experience in the private or public sector. Specialized experience must demonstrate the following: 1) Providing curriculum quality assurance and audit management support in the evaluation of training programs, document filing, database maintenance, and completion of special projects. (2) Following established guidelines to assist with development of curriculum support documents such as Training Project Plans, Training Course Control Documents, Lesson Plan, Trainee Guide and Instructional Media Materials and Testing Plans. (3) Using Authoring Instructional Materials, Content Planning Module/Learning Object Module authoring tools software and training support databases such as Corporate Enterprise Training Activity Resource System (CeTARs) program. Education In lieu of specialized experience, you may qualify with the following education or combination of both education and experience: For the GS-09 position: Successful completion of a master's or equivalent graduate degree in Education or a subject area related to the position to be filled. OR Successful completion of two full years of progressively higher level graduate education leading to a master's degree in Education or a subject area related to the position to be filled. OR Possession of an LL.B. or J.D. that is related to this position being filled. https://www.usajobs.gov/Help/working-in-government/unique-hiring-paths/students/federal-occupations-by-college-major/ OR A combination of experience and graduate education as described above that equates to one year of experience. For the GS-07 position:1 full year of graduate level education in Education or a subject area related to the position to be filled. OR Successful completion of a bachelor's degree in Education or a subject area related to the position to be filled with superior academic achievement. OR A combination of experience and graduate education as described above that equates to one year of experience A transcript must be submitted with your application if qualifying using education.
